Voice is a grammatical category that applies to verbs. Voice expresses the relationship of the subject to the action.
In a sentence written in the active voice, the subject of sentence performs the action stated by the verb. In a sentence written in the passive voice the subject receives the action.
Passive voice is used when the focus is on the action. It is not important or not known who or what is performing the action.

The term phrasal verb is commonly applied to two or three distinct but related constructions in English: a verb and a particle and/or a preposition co-occur forming a single semantic unit. A phrasal verb is a verb plus a preposition or adverb which creates a meaning different from the original verb.
This semantic unit cannot be understood based upon the meanings of the individual parts in isolation, but rather it can be taken as a whole. Phrasal verbs that include a preposition are known as prepositional verbs and phrasal verbs that include a particle are also known as particle verbs.
